In the realm of professional sports, the Sacramento Kings stand out not only for their plays on the basketball court but also for their significant contributions off the court. As stewards of community engagement, the Kings have set a standard for how sports franchises can play a crucial role in enriching their local communities. From educational programs to sustainability initiatives, the Kings' commitment to Sacramento is evident in their extensive and impactful community involvement.

 

 

Since relocating to Sacramento in 1985, the Kings have taken a proactive approach to community service, understanding that their influence extends beyond entertainment. The organization has launched several initiatives aimed at addressing key community needs, intertwining their operations with efforts to improve the quality of life in Sacramento.

 

 

In partnership with the Build.Black. Coalition, the Sacramento Kings have created the Kings and Queens Rise basketball league, which focuses on social justice through sports. The league provides a platform for youth to engage in constructive activities while learning about leadership, confidence, and community building. "It's about more than just basketball," explains Matina Kolokotronis, the Kings' Chief Operating Officer. "We’re cultivating a space for young people to grow and connect in a positive, supportive environment."

 

 

The Golden 1 Center, home to the Kings, is not only a state-of-the-art sports facility but also a global leader in environmental and sustainability efforts. It's the world’s first indoor sports venue to achieve LEED Platinum certification, setting a new standard for environmental responsibility in sports. "Our goal was to make the Golden 1 Center a beacon of technology and sustainability," says Chris Granger, former President of the Kings. The arena utilizes solar energy, sources food locally to reduce carbon footprint, and utilizes advanced cooling systems to conserve water.

 

 

Understanding the importance of technology in education, the Kings have initiated several programs to boost tech accessibility in schools. These include donating tablets and laptops, funding tech labs, and providing digital literacy workshops for students and teachers. "By integrating technology into our community programs, we are opening doors for the next generation of leaders," remarks Ryan Montoya, the Chief Technology Officer of the Kings.

 

 

The response from the community has been overwhelmingly positive. School principals report increased student engagement and improved educational outcomes as a result of the Kings' tech initiatives. Parents and youth participating in the Kings and Queens Rise league express gratitude for the safe spaces and valuable life lessons their children receive.

 

Statistics further illustrate the success of these initiatives, with participating schools observing a noticeable improvement in student performance and attendance. The environmental efforts of the Golden 1 Center have inspired other local businesses to adopt more sustainable practices, amplifying the impact of the Kings' initiatives.

 

 

The Kings’ efforts underscore the importance of corporate social responsibility (CSR) in professional sports. By leveraging their platform and resources, sports teams have a unique opportunity to effect significant changes in their communities. "It’s our responsibility to use our visibility to make a difference," says Vivek Ranadivé, owner of the Sacramento Kings. "We are more than a basketball team; we are a positive force in Sacramento."

 

 

 

The Sacramento Kings' commitment to community involvement and charitable contributions demonstrates a blueprint for how sports organizations can positively influence their surroundings. Through thoughtful initiatives and genuine engagement, the Kings have fostered a strong bond with Sacramento, showing that the true power of sports lies in the ability to unite and uplift communities. Their ongoing efforts not only enhance the lives of their fans but also enrich the broader community, proving that in the world of sports, the greatest victories often occur off the court.
